Urgent Aid For Businesses & Freelancers Who Service The Live Events Sector
Rejected
21 signatures
What the petition asks
1 Grants for businesses in the events supply chain
2 Furlough extended until the industry can get back to work
3 Self employment grants tailored towards the industry
4 Business rates for our sector to be frozen
5 Reduce Corporation Tax and Income Tax

This sector at large has been discarded by government with no industry specific measures to help.
Without major immediate support from government, the entire supply chain is at risk of collapse.
The value of the UK Events Industry totals £84 Billion
Conferences & Meetings £18.3 bn
Exhibitions & Trade Fairs £11 bn
Incentive Travel £1.2 bn
Arts & Culture Events £5.6 bn
Corporate Outdoor £0.7 bn
Weddings £14 bn
Music events £17.6 bn
Festivals, Fairs & Shows £6 bn
Sporting Events £6.9 bn
